This role is an upgrade from the standard Material Stocker position, focusing on training and development. The Material Stocker Trainer is responsible for training, certifying, and recertifying production associates on material stocking processes to ensure adherence to safety, quality, and productivity standards. This includes staying current with process changes, creating and updating documentation, and recommending improvements to training content. The trainer will also conduct new hire orientations, covering essential safety, quality, and performance requirements, including SAP T-codes and other technical skills. They must be capable of objectively evaluating the performance of other Material Stockers and possess the self-discipline to train and work independently. The role involves conducting audits of Material Stocker performance, providing documented feedback to leadership, and participating in regular training meetings to address safety, quality, and performance trends. Coordination with management is required for creating monthly training schedules and ensuring timely recertification. The Trainer, Material Stocker must also perform all duties in accordance with company policies, participate in safety programs, I-engage and I-observe programs, and Kaizen/6S events. They will assist in safety inspections and 6S audits, maintain housekeeping standards, and actively contribute to the production team through feedback on process development and continuous improvement. Effective communication and performance, both independently and in a team, are essential. The role requires a self-motivated individual with strong prioritization and organizational skills, and a solid understanding of T-codes.
